Madjid Samii (born 19 June 1937 in Rasht, Iran) is an Iranian physician and prominent neurosurgeon. And is currently president of the World Federation of Neurological Surgeons Society, adviser to the German chancellor and chief adviser to the president of China Hospital, neurosciences Hannover, Germany. He has trained many students around the world who are engaged in activities in the field of neurosurgery. Madjid Samii finished elementary and secondary education in Rasht and then was off to Germany. He completed the fields of biology and medicine at the Johannes Gutenberg University. And the specialty of neurosurgery began under Professor Kurt Shvrmn. And in 1960 he was awarded the degree of expertise in this field.
